Why retail standardization becomes harder as location count increases
A single store can often compensate for weak process design through local experience and manual workarounds. A regional chain cannot. As locations expand, every inconsistency compounds: product setup errors distort replenishment, local spreadsheet pricing undermines margin control, delayed goods receipt affects stock accuracy, and inconsistent returns handling damages both customer experience and financial reconciliation. What appears to be a technology problem is usually an operating model problem. Retailers need a framework that distinguishes enterprise standards from local execution choices.
The most effective retail ERP operating frameworks focus on five control points. First, master data must be governed centrally enough to preserve consistency in products, suppliers, pricing structures, tax logic, and chart-of-accounts alignment. Second, transactional workflows must be standardized where they affect financial integrity, inventory accuracy, and customer commitments. Third, local flexibility should be explicitly defined rather than informally tolerated. Fourth, reporting must provide operational visibility at both store and enterprise levels. Fifth, architecture decisions must support resilience, security, and future integration rather than short-term convenience.
The decision framework: what to standardize, what to localize
Retail leaders often make one of two mistakes. They either over-standardize and frustrate local operations, or they over-localize and lose control. A better approach is to classify processes by business risk and strategic value. Processes tied to financial control, compliance, inventory integrity, and brand consistency should usually be standardized. Processes tied to local merchandising nuance, staffing realities, or region-specific customer engagement may allow controlled variation. This is where Enterprise Architecture and Governance matter: the ERP should reflect policy, not replace it.
| Process Area | Recommended Model | Why It Matters |
|---|---|---|
| Product master, supplier master, tax rules, chart of accounts | Central standardization | Protects data quality, reporting consistency, and compliance |
| Purchase approvals, goods receipt, stock adjustments, returns controls | Standardized with role-based exceptions | Reduces shrinkage, improves auditability, and supports inventory accuracy |
| Store replenishment parameters and local assortment extensions | Central policy with local thresholds | Balances enterprise control with local demand realities |
| Promotions, customer service workflows, and regional campaigns | Controlled localization | Preserves brand governance while enabling market responsiveness |
| Executive reporting, KPI definitions, and financial close | Enterprise standardization | Enables comparable performance management across locations |
In Odoo ERP, this framework can be operationalized through role design, approval rules, company structures, document controls, and workflow automation. Relevant applications may include Inventory, Purchase, Sales, Accounting, CRM, Documents, Helpdesk, and Studio when tailored forms or approval flows are needed. The goal is not to deploy every module. It is to use the minimum application footprint that solves the operating problem while preserving future extensibility.
Designing the target operating model in Odoo ERP
A strong target operating model starts with business capabilities, not screens. Retailers should define how assortment planning, procurement, stock movement, store transfers, customer service, returns, and financial close are expected to work across all locations. Only then should the ERP configuration be designed. Odoo ERP supports this well because it can unify front-office and back-office processes on a common data model, reducing the fragmentation that often appears when separate systems are used for inventory, purchasing, service, and finance.
For expanding retailers, Multi-company Management becomes relevant when the business operates multiple legal entities, regional subsidiaries, or distinct brands with separate accounting and governance requirements. It should not be used casually. Overuse can create unnecessary complexity in intercompany flows, reporting, and security. Where the business is operationally unified, a simpler structure with shared standards and location-level controls may be more effective. This is a classic architecture trade-off: legal and reporting needs must be balanced against administrative overhead.
- Use Inventory and Purchase to standardize replenishment, receiving, transfers, and supplier controls across locations.
- Use Accounting to enforce consistent financial treatment, period close discipline, and enterprise reporting structures.
- Use CRM, Sales, and Helpdesk when customer lifecycle management and service consistency are strategic priorities.
- Use Documents and Knowledge when store procedures, SOPs, and policy-controlled documentation must be accessible and governed.
- Use Studio selectively for business-specific forms and approvals, but avoid excessive customization that weakens upgradeability.
Architecture choices: Multi-tenant SaaS, Dedicated Cloud, and integration strategy
Retail ERP standardization is not only a process question; it is also an infrastructure and integration question. Enterprises expanding across locations need to decide whether a Multi-tenant SaaS model provides sufficient control, or whether a Dedicated Cloud approach is more appropriate for integration depth, security posture, performance isolation, or governance requirements. There is no universal answer. Multi-tenant SaaS can reduce operational burden and accelerate standard deployments. Dedicated Cloud can be more suitable when retailers require tighter control over integration patterns, observability, data residency considerations, or specialized operational resilience measures.
For Odoo ERP environments with broader enterprise requirements, an API-first Architecture is often the most sustainable path. Retailers typically need integration with POS ecosystems, eCommerce platforms, payment services, logistics providers, tax engines, identity providers, and Business Intelligence environments. Integration should be designed as a governed capability, not a collection of one-off connectors. Cloud-native Architecture components such as Kubernetes, Docker, PostgreSQL, and Redis may become relevant in Dedicated Cloud scenarios where scalability, workload isolation, and operational control matter. Identity and Access Management, Monitoring, and Observability are equally important because standardized processes fail quickly when access is inconsistent or issues are detected too late.
| Architecture Option | Best Fit | Trade-off |
|---|---|---|
| Multi-tenant SaaS | Retailers prioritizing speed, lower operational overhead, and standard platform use | Less control over infrastructure-level design and some enterprise-specific operating requirements |
| Dedicated Cloud | Retailers needing stronger governance, integration flexibility, performance isolation, or managed operational resilience | Higher architecture and operating discipline required |
| Hybrid integration landscape | Retailers modernizing in phases while retaining selected legacy systems | Greater integration complexity and stronger governance needed to avoid process fragmentation |

Implementation roadmap for process standardization across locations
The implementation roadmap should follow business risk, not module popularity. Start by identifying the processes that most directly affect margin, customer commitments, and financial control. In retail, these usually include product and supplier master data, purchasing, receiving, stock accuracy, transfers, returns, and financial reconciliation. Once those are stabilized, customer-facing and optimization-oriented capabilities can be expanded. This sequencing reduces disruption and creates a measurable foundation for Business Process Optimization.
A practical roadmap usually begins with operating model design and process harmonization workshops. Next comes master data governance, including ownership, approval rules, and data quality standards. Then the core Odoo applications are configured for standardized workflows, followed by enterprise integration design, security controls, and reporting definitions. Pilot deployment should occur in a representative subset of locations rather than the easiest stores. The pilot must test exceptions, not just happy-path transactions. After that, rollout can proceed in waves with clear cutover criteria, training by role, and post-go-live stabilization supported by Monitoring and Observability.
Best practices that improve retail ERP outcomes
The strongest programs treat standardization as a governance discipline rather than a one-time implementation task. Executive sponsorship should define non-negotiable enterprise standards. Process owners should approve local exceptions through a formal mechanism. KPI definitions should be locked before rollout so stores are measured consistently. Reporting should combine operational visibility with actionability, not just historical summaries. Where AI-assisted ERP capabilities are considered, they should be applied to forecasting support, anomaly detection, service triage, or workflow recommendations only after data quality and process discipline are mature enough to support reliable outcomes.
Common mistakes that create long-term complexity
- Treating each new location as a special case and gradually rebuilding fragmentation inside the ERP.
- Customizing around weak process decisions instead of redesigning the operating model.
- Ignoring Master Data Management until after rollout, which undermines inventory, purchasing, and reporting accuracy.
- Allowing integration projects to proceed without ownership, version control, and exception handling standards.
- Underestimating security, role design, and segregation of duties in multi-location operations.
- Measuring success by go-live dates rather than process adoption, control quality, and business outcomes.
Business ROI, risk mitigation, and executive recommendations
The ROI of retail ERP operating frameworks should be evaluated through control improvement and scalability, not only labor savings. Standardized processes can reduce stock inaccuracies, improve replenishment discipline, shorten issue resolution cycles, strengthen compliance, and make performance comparable across locations. They also lower the cost of opening new stores because the business is no longer reinventing workflows, reports, and controls each time it expands. For CIOs and CFOs, this creates a more predictable operating base for growth.
Risk mitigation should be designed into the framework from the start. Security must include role-based access, Identity and Access Management alignment, and periodic review of privileged permissions. Compliance should be reflected in approval workflows, document retention, and financial controls. Operational Resilience requires backup discipline, recovery planning, monitoring thresholds, and support ownership. Integration resilience matters as much as application resilience because retail operations often depend on external systems for payments, logistics, and digital commerce. Managed Cloud Services can be valuable when internal teams or partners need stronger operational support for uptime, patching, observability, and incident response.
Executive recommendations are straightforward. First, define the operating framework before debating features. Second, standardize the processes that protect margin, compliance, and customer trust. Third, localize only where there is a clear commercial reason. Fourth, invest early in master data governance and reporting definitions. Fifth, choose architecture based on control, resilience, and integration needs rather than trend preference. Sixth, treat rollout as a capability-building program, not a software event. Retailers that follow this sequence are better positioned to scale without losing operational coherence.
